Purchase price: $850,000 Cash invested: $140,000 Sale price: $1,476,500 Source: Cold Call12 unit multi familyPurchase: $850kLoan 1$250k 1st position loan (down payment to seller)2 yr balloon,12% interest onlyLoan 2$600k 2nd position seller finance3yr balloon, 0% interest, 30 yr am, 8 month deferred paymentsThree 4 unit buildings.

Cash flow-oriented investors would do well in this market, since Montgomery’s rent-to-price ratios are very favorable—for instance, we’re seeing $150,000 properties in B/B+ neighborhoods fetch monthly gross rents of $1,200 to $1,300.By the way, if you’re looking for financing, a debt service coverage ratio (DSCR) loan could be a good option for you since you’re an international investor.
